Check out DVDfab Decrypter. That will rip the files and save them to a folder on your hd. Don't save as an .iso unless you're planning on burning again right away. As far as I know, there's not a program that will open and play an .iso file.

i've never actually used auto guardian knot, but if you want it on your computer you'll probably want to rip it from the dvd then enode it as an avi file so its not using up as much space while maintaining quality. there might be a better way, but i havent really updated my encoding techniques of late.

if you just want to keep the whole dvd on your computer then dvdshrink or dvd decrypter. below is a video tech site with guides. click guides on the left side, then dvd/mini dvd, then it will show the dvd backup guide section. using dvdshrink once you put the disc in your drive it will analyze it for 5-10 minutes for quality purposes, then once you've started ripping it to the hard drive, maybe an hour.

AGK is a good program. Super C encoder is also a good one.

Basically, cack, if you're trying to "rip" the DVD then be able to watch it on your laptop by clicking a file, you need to use a ripping software, like DVDFab decrypter, then use AGK (crowcutta's first link) to encode to an .avi file. XviD or DivX format. To play it, you may need to download those codecs, just google XviD DivX codec pack.

Beware though, if you have a semi-slow PC, it can take a good while to convert the raw dvd files (video_ts folder) to a watchable .avi file.

If you just want to watch it, rip the vobs and use VLC media player to watch. The only thing I convert anymore is if I want to put it on my Ipod. Super is a great program for that.
